windows keep asking me what program to open with...

Featured Replies

this's jusy annoying , Windows just ask me to choose program to open with for every file type. even i ticked at "Always use the selected program ... " next time it still ask what program to open this file.

Also other icons turn into unknown icon types

Does anyone know how fix this ??

thnaks a lot

Hi

Maybe this will help you

Go To

MyComputer-->Tools--->FolderOptions

and under the file types tab, associate the program you want to open certain file types.

You dont have to go through them all, just your most used.

I am having the same problem. But just with windows media player files like wmv.

I did check the box too. (always use the selected program to open this kind of file)

When I look in the file type tab, windows media player is already associated with this type of file but I still get prompted asking me what I would like to open with....

This is what is in the OPEN command in the advanced section in the file types tab:

"C:\Program Files\Windows Media Player\wmplayer.exe" /prefetch:7 /Open "%L"

Is this correct?

Anyone now how to fix it?

I think it may have been a registry setting.

thanks

Go into Folder Options > Click the filetype, click "Advanced", click "Open", click "Edit", browse to WMP (I suggest you use Media Player Classic ;)), click OK. Click Change Icon, browse to WMP executable, click icon you desire, click OK. Finished. Fixed?

Edited by Jeremy

Hey Jeremy

Thats exactly what I was doing but for some reason it never saved the setting. :angry:

Well I got tired of messing with it so I ended up just reinstalling WMP10 and now it works fine.
